Ambika Flavel is a Lecturer in Forensic Anthropology at the University of Western Australia (UWA), affiliated with the School of Social Sciences. She leads the Centre for Forensic Anthropology and coordinates popular courses like 'Mysteries of Forensic Science' and 'Archaeology of Death'. Her research focuses on bioarchaeology, forensic archaeology, and the application of CT imaging in anthropological studies.
- PhD in Forensic Anthropology from UWA (Topic: Camposanto: Plague in the Venetian Republic)
Her key research projects include the Camposanto Bioarchaeology Project (Venice plague cemetery studies) and the Saudi Arabian Bioarchaeology Project (UNESCO site analysis at Hegra). She is an Associate Editor of the Australian Journal of Forensic Sciences and a member of the American Academy of Forensic Sciences and Australian and New Zealand Forensic Science Society.
Her recent articles explore forensic identification through skeletal analysis, population affinity via cranial measurements, and historical case studies like the Batavia shipwreck.
